Welcome to your Expo app 👋

This is an Expo project created with create-expo-app.

Get started

  1. Install dependencies

    npm install
    
  2. Start the app

    npx expo start
    

In the output, you'll find options to open the app in a

You can start developing by editing the files inside the app directory. This project uses file-based routing.

Get a fresh project

When you're ready, run:

npm run reset-project

This command will move the starter code to the app-example directory and create a blank app directory where you can start developing.

Dictation debugging

Set EXPO_PUBLIC_ENABLE_AUDIO_DEBUG=1 before running npx expo start to render the in-app audio debug card. Pair it with the server-side STT_DEBUG_AUDIO_DIR flag so every dictation includes a copyable path to the saved raw audio file.
